LEGACY STEER ROPING YUMA AZ NPP FEBRUARY 7 YUMA SILVER SPUR RODEO LEGACY STEER ROPING
ARENA: Yuma County Fairgrounds ADDRESS: 2520 East 32nd Street PERFS: 1 Perf: February 7-8:30 AM EVENTS: SR SPECIAL ENTRY FEES: SR-$200 PERMITS: SR
STK. CONT.: ANDREWS RODEO EOO: 10:00 AM MT JANUARY 28 EC: 10:00 AM MT JANUARY 29
GROUND RULES: Contestants who choose to enter the Legacy Steer Roping event must be at least 50 years old or a permit holder at the time of entry closing. They must also be entered in the steer roping event at the Yuma Jaycees Silver Spur Rodeo. To be eligible, the contestant must not have been an NFSR qualifier during the past 3 years. Permit members of all ages will also be eligible to enter. Contestants will pay an additional entry fees of $200. Contestants will not compete on any additional steers. The times that are recorded for the contestants’ competition runs at the Yuma Jaycees Silver Spur Rodeo will be used to determine the pay-off. Pay-off will only include the entry fees for the contestants who entered the Legacy Steer Roping through PROCOM. 6% will be held out of the total amount for the PRCA prior to the pay-off. Only the two go-rounds and the average after two go-rounds will be included in the pay-off for the Legacy Steer Roping. There will be no additional added money and since no additional animals will be run, there will be no additional stock charge or PROCOM charge. Money won in the Legacy Steer Roping will not count towards PRCA World Standings, circuit standings, All Around standings, or for money won qualifications. It will count towards qualifying for the Legacy Steer Roping Finals held in conjunction with the National Finals Steer Roping.
